Linkedin co-founder Reid Hoffman had sold the social network to Microsoft for $26.2 billion in 2016.

The same year, Hoffman became a board member at Microsoft.

How much did Reid Hoffman make?

Hoffman made an estimated sum of $2.34 billion.

LinkedIn recently cut down over 700 jobs and closed its app in China, with the aim of “streamlining the firm’s operations.”

More About LinkedIn

LinkedIn is a professional networking platform focused on business and employment, with ease of access via websites and mobile apps.

Founded by American entrepreneur Reid Hoffman, the social networking site was launched on May 5, 2003, and traded to Microsoft in 2016.

As of March 2023, LinkedIn recorded over 900 million registered members drawn from at least 200 countries.

LinkedIn is a platform that enables employees, jobseekers and employers to create professional profiles and connect with each other.

LinkedIn Members can invite both new and existing members to connect. The platform is also used to “organize offline events, create professional groups, write articles, publish job postings, post photos and videos, and other activities.”
